The car we are reconstructing has the rear shock plate rusted. Basically, the area just behind the back seat cushion area back over the hump to where the mounts are for the trunk hinges are located.

Usually this does not rust, but our car was sitting for a long time. Mice nested in the under side where the shocks mount. Caused rust.

We need a new part and it is not in any of the cats we have. Any one have any ideas of a fix, or have a 67-8 parts car that we cud have that part??
